PT Z adalah perusahaan yang bergerak di bidang perkapalan dan jasa maritim. Kegiatan bisnis utama dari PT Z adalah jasa pengangkutan pasokan bahan baku bagi kegiatan lepas pantai dan pengangkutan bbm ke wilayah di Indonesia melalui jalur perairan yang tidak dapat dilalui oleh kapal - kapal besar. Dalam menjalankan kegiatan bisnisnya PT Z tidak lepas dari risiko bahaya baik bagi pekerjanya, lingkungan di sekitar area kerja dan aset properti perusahaan. PT Z menetapkan strategi dan penerapan aspek keselamatan kerja secara konsisten untuk mencegah terjadinya insiden keselamatan kerja agar aspek tersebut dapat menjadi daya saing bagi perusahaan dan nilai tambah bagi bisnis perusahaan.
Sesuai dengan peraturan pemerintah No 45 Tahun 2012 tetang manajemen keselamatan kapal bahwa setiap perusahaan pelayaran harus memenuhi persyaratan manajemen keselamatan dan pencegahan pencemaran dari kapal. Sedangkan sistem manajemen keselamatan yang yang sesuai persyaratan adalah International Safety Management (ISM) Code yaitu koda internasional tentang manajemen keselamatan pengoperasian kapal dan pencegahan pencemaran sebagaimana yang diatur dalam Bab IX Konvensi SOLAS 1974 yang telah diamandemen.
Hasil yang paling signifikan dari penelitian ini adalah tingkat penerapan sistem manajemen keselamatan kelautan di kapal masih belum maksimal dan berpengaruh terhadap keselamatan kerja. Hal ini tergambar pada variable penelitian kepatuhan crew terhadap porsedur SMK Kelautan. Hasil penelitian menunjukan bahwa crew tidak sepenuhnya patuh pada prosedur yang ditetapkan. Hasil penelitian juga menunjukan belum maksimalnya penerapan sistem manejemen keselamatan kelautan di darat. Hal ini tergambar pada variable kebijakan dan prosedur. Hasil penelitian menunjukan bahwa prosedur yang ditetapkan oleh perusahaan tidak mudah dimengerti.
PT Z is a company engaged in the field of shipping and maritime services. The main business activity of PT Z is a transportation service for the supply of raw materials and transportation of offshore activities in the area of fuel into Indonesia through the waterway impassable by boat - big boat. In the course of business of PT Z is not free from the risk of danger is good for workers, the environment around the work area and property assets of the company. PT Z set the strategy and implementation of consistent safety aspects to prevent the occurrence of safety incidents so that these aspects can be a competitive edge for the company and add value to the business enterprise.
In accordance with government regulation No 45 of 2012 neighbors vessel safety management that any shipping company must meet the requirements of safety management and the prevention of pollution from ships. While the safety management system that suits the requirements of the International Safety Management (ISM) Code is an international code of safety management operation of the ship and the prevention of pollution as provided for in Chapter IX of the SOLAS Convention 1974 as amended. The most significant result of this study is the level of implementation of the safety management system on board marine still not up and affect safety. This is reflected in the research variable adherence to porsedur SMK Marine crew.
The results showed that the crew did not fully comply with established procedures. The results also show the application of the system not maximal manejemen marine safety on land. This is reflected in the variable policies and procedures. The results showed that the procedures established by the company are not easy to understand.
Employee perceptions of implementation occupational health and safety management system (OHSMS) is the view of employees to what is given the company aims to secure the safety and health of employees work. The main objective of this study was to determine the employees' perception of the implementation occupational health and safety management system at PT. X. PT. X is a heavy equipment distributor that has the level of hazard and risk is quite high for employees working in the field. This research is descriptive analytic. With the number of respondents involved in this study as many as 133 people. This study was conducted using questionnaires. PT. X has implemented an occupational health and safety management system throughout the work area by integrating based on OHSAS 18001 and PP 50 in 2012.
The office sector located in high-rise buildings has the potential for significant fire hazards and risks. This study focuses on the analysis of active protection systems, passive protection systems, means of escape, and fire safety management at PT XYZ Head Office. The research design uses an observational study with a semi-quantitative approach. Data collecting is gathered through direct observation, interviews, document review, and using the checklist sheet instrument. Data analysis is performed by comparing the actual conditions with Peraturan Menteri Pekerjaan Umum Nomor 26/PRT/M/2008, Peraturan Menteri Kesehatan No. 48 Tahun 2016, Peraturan Menteri Pekerjaan Umum No. 20 Tahun 2009, and Standar Nasional Indonesia (SNI). According to the results of the study, the active fire protection system obtained a percentage level of conformity of 85,2% with good criteria, the passive fire protection system obtained a percentage level of conformity of 66,6% with sufficient criteria, means of escape obtained a percentage level of conformity of 91,5% with good criteria, and fire safety management obtained the percentage of conformity level of 91,8% with good criteria. In general, the elements of fire protection systems and fire safety management at PT XYZ Head Office have complied with regulations and standards with an average percentage of 83,7%.
